Gerald Sawyer Garner, age 86, of Somerset, Kentucky, passed away on June 11, 2025 surrounded by loved ones. Born on May 30, 1939, to the late Earl Pratt and Polly Sawyer Garner, Gerald was a lifelong resident of Somerset and a man deeply rooted in faith, family, and community.
A proud retired member of the Army Reserve, Gerald honorably served his country during both the Korean War and Operation Desert Storm. After his military service, he spent many dedicated years working at Crane Plumbing before retiring.
On September 23, 1961, Gerald married the love of his life, Joan Carolyn Branscum, and together they built a life full of devotion, joy, and shared purpose.
Gerald had a deep love for the simple joys in life-riding his motorcycle and horses, caring for his many animals, and collecting firearms. He was passionate about his family, his faith, and his church. A committed member of Beacon Hill Baptist Church, Gerald served faithfully as a deacon and found great joy in the fellowship of his church family. His love for Jesus Christ was at the very heart of his life.
